Useless and pathetic service
I queried my bill at the local MTN dealer which revered me to some account manager whom in turn advised me to e-mail MTN about the situation. Then I wrote the 1st e-mail to MTN on 2014-10-27. The 2nd e-mail was send on 2014-12-03 and the 3rd e-mail on 2015-03-12. I received acknowledgement of receipt on every e-mail and up to date nothing has been done about the matter. It is now more than 6 months later and still no reply as to what the situation is. Well done MTN it really is a brilliant way of making money, by sending your customer a message saying that you will message him when his account reaches R500 and then you only send him a message telling him his account has now reached R2800 and then you bill him for the amount of almost R3700 and when he queries the situation you just ignore him.
We truly are sorry for any inconvenience caused.
We have now perused your account and see that you were charged for Roamed calls in October 2014. A response was sent to you by Arthur Khambule (Corporate Credit Controller).
What you will need to remember is that when you are roaming, you are connected to a foreign network and the charges for your number firstly needs to be downloaded from the foreign network and then our Credit Controllers are able to attend to the matter.
We've escalated the matter directly to our Credit Management team and requested them to contact you and resolve the matter accordingly pertaining to the invoiced amount of R3553.27 for October 2015.
